SEIU MICHIGAN HEALTH AND WELFARE FUND, founded in 1950, is a community nonprofit that reported $3.9M in total revenue in fiscal year 2022. Revenue decreased 15% compared to the prior year. Expenses of $6.3M exceeded revenue, resulting in a 63% operating deficit.

Mission

THE FUND IS CREATED, ESTABLISHED, AND MAINTAINED FOR THE PURPOSE OF PROVIDING ELIGIBLE EMPLOYEES AND THEIR DEPENDENTS AND/OR BENEFICIARIES WITH MEDICAL, SURGICAL, AND HOSPITAL CARE; BENEFITS IN THE EVENT OF SICKNESS, ACCIDENT, DISABILITY, DEATH, OR UNEMPLOYMENT; AND DENTAL, OPTICAL, AND PRESCRIPTION DRUG CARE; AND FOR THE PURPOSE OF DEFRAYING REASONABLE COST OF ADMINISTRATION.
